Home Diffuser Tips Like a Pro
- Begin with less and increase gradually.
- Don’t place it under AC vents for stable performance.
- Run it in cycles to prevent scent fatigue.
- Clean regularly to keep the fragrance pure.

Common Mistakes People Make With Diffusers
-
Overdosing:
it can feel heavy. Build up slowly.
-
Wrong placement:
putting it near fans reduces consistency.
-
Skipping maintenance:
residue can create stale notes.
-
Over-blending:
it can create confusing smells.
